By Kyle GunnCurtis Main insists that St Mirren need to get used to breaking teams down after losing 1-0 at home to a stuffy Dundee side last weekend.
Saints had 62 percent of the ball but they couldn’t break James McPake’s side down after Scotland under-21 midfielder Max Anderson’s early strike which gave the visitors all three points.
Despite the former Aberdeen striker partnering fellow attacker Eamonn Brophy up front the Buddies just couldn’t break the resistance of a spirited Dee defensive unit.
